Perspective

Its a matter of perspective
All in your point of view
Just don’t sweat the small stuff
And, stuff won’t get to you,
Its all in how we look at things
That will decide what each day brings
The limits of our vision scope
A presumptive part of wish and hope,
Our attitude, our turn of mind
Do we look ahead, or look behind
The horizon of our line of sight
Is it a must, or maybe might,
Our stand, our slant, our very stance
The reference frame by which we chance
The panoramic angle that we play
The idiosyncrasies of our day,
Opinion, notion, bias, bent
As others scan the message sent
The overall impression that we make
Reflects “perspective” that we take!

D.C. Butterfield
